Mysqlnd driver cpanel login

How to fix your php installation appears to be missing. Access your server via ssh and access the directory. Yes old driver is no more provided in fedora packages since 5. This document lists the php options available in easyapache 4. I know that easy apache has the option to add mysqli and everything but, since we installed mssql driver to the server, everytime we try to make. For more information about how to install a php package with yum, read our how to locate and install a php version or extension documentation. For one cpanel accounts select php version, i chose php 5.

Database connection error, mysqls godaddy community. Enabling mysqlnd from cpanel from your hosting account to add. To manage a huge volume of data efficiently, we store the data in tables, a group of many. The mysql database extensions mysql extension, mysqli and pdo mysql all communicate with the mysql server. In order to do this, you must connect your script to the database with a configuration file. Hello kenny, as this was something done by the managed hosting team, you will likely want to reach out to them to see if they can help. I have created simple php to access a table at the database, but when i tried to access it, it gave the message below.

An aluminium reseller account includes up to 30 free transfers. The mysql native driver for php mysqlnd is licensed under the terms of the php license to solve any license issues. Once you enable both native drivers this function works as documented. The mysql native driver for php will simply be referred as mysqlnd from this point, is an additional, alternative way to connect from php 5 and php 6 to the mysql server 4. I unfortunately am in charge of a server infested with cpanel. Mysql connectors mysql provides standardsbased drivers for jdbc, odbc, and. Weve found it impossible to use the mysqlnd driver for the php mysql extension since it does not support the 323 style short password hash fallback that the normal libmysqlclient handles during authentication. From now on you can use extmysqli either together with libmysql as you did in the past or with mysqlnd. Once you have selected the php version as current, tick on the option that says mysqli andor mysqlnd from the options presented and click save.

In the past, this was done by the extension using the services provided by the mysql client library. The php mysql extensions are lightweight wrappers on top of a c client library. August 2019 knowledge base penguinbliss web hosting. This post will help you to install mysqlnd with php on a centos cpanel installed server. Unfortunately, most documentation only ever talks about the mysqlnd native driver. Enabling mysqlnd from cpanel from your hosting account to. Mysql native driver is part of the official php sources as of php 5. For more information, read our how to use server profiles documentation.

If you are not sure where your configuration file is, check this list of different scripts to find its location. Since easyapache 4 uses mysqlnd the mysql native driver this will need to be addressed before upgrading since mysqlnd does not support older hash. You might want to install the the mysql native driver for php mysqlnd over the custom mysql driver provided with the default easyapache. The mysql database extensions mysql extension, mysqli and.

If you install either of these, the system will disable mysql of the system and use mysqlnd, the mysql native driver, instead. For various reasons ive been attempting to get the mysqlnd driver compiled into php. It is a replacement for libmysql, the mysql client library. Hello, has anyone encountered errors with mysqli on typo3. We are getting 503 errors if we setup typo3 to use the mysqli driver but it runs just fine if we change the driver to. Cloudlinux os is the superplatform for stability and efficiency in shared hosting, developed to address the unique needs of web hosts.

Mysql native driver for php mysqlnd is that the php 5. If you do not have any time left with them, you may also want to reach out to our live support team for specific configuration and what may be causing the issue. Question about mysql version installed cpanel forums. Install multiple php versions using easyapache 4 liquid web. Go to your cpanel and scroll down to select php versions, here you can change your php version, or change your available plugins for your account. Mysqli support from cpanel by default it must be checked for your hosting depends on the version of php you are using, you can enable or disable this by visiting cpanel and then php version link. The mysql native driver for php is an additional, alternative way to connect from php 6 to the mysql server 4. We strongly recommend that you update all of your mysql database password hashes before you upgrade to easyapache 4. How to install php extensions inside cpanel youtube.

On the clevel mysqlnd uses many of the proven and stable php internal functions. The extensions can either use the mysqlnd or libmysql library to connect from php to mysql. Mysql native driver is a replacement for the mysql client library libmysqlclient. Login to whm and access easyapache 4 by using the search bar. These changes can be done for shared hosting also without contacting your hosting support enabling mysqlnd. Most web hosting companies or even individual uses cpanel whm to control their web server behavior and for ease of use, but cpanel does not install all the extension that may be required to run a php application. The mysql native driver for php mysqlnd is a dropin replacement for the mysql client library libmysql for the php script language. Net enabling developers to build database applications in their language of choice. Out of this 30, you can have 20 cpanel to cpanel transfers and 10 manual transfers, or any. Even if that is the case, according to cpanel php inherit feature, when apache looks up for the php version of the subdomain, it finds php inherit setting and it traverses nth levels above to find parent. You will need root privileges and ssh access to compile it.

Please note that this does require that your old hosts cpanel backup generator to be active. How to connect to the mysql database hostgator support. How to fix your php installation appears to be missing the mysql. If your server doesnt have rvsitebuilder licensed, you can purchase it now here, or require a rvsitebuilder 15day trial license here. Maybe its an obvious question, but i want to be sure. You will get this error due to missing mysqlnd driver on server. Hi guys i have plesk hosting windows with godaddy, ive created a database and i successfully connected remotely with it. In addition, a native c library allows developers to embed mysql directly into their applications. If you get a vps however and you have cpanel, you can change the configuration options for php. The use of the php library mysqlnd is not supported on some of the larger hosting sites for example siteground. Im assuming youre using mysqli, else i think youll need to use withmysql mysqlnd instead. I have just downloaded this latest version, so i will give this a try.

On phpinfoing the both, the local machine shows mysqlnd driver installed, but the hosting server has not. In phpinfo mysqlnd is listed but only with this i cant be sure if im using mysqlnd or the old driver. I would need to install the mysqlnd driver for php, however am using a cpanel server and have to use easy apache. All the code of the new driver is contained in the ext mysqlnd directory of the php source code as of php 5. Php modules and extensions on shared hosting servers namecheap. The mysql client library sets a default timeout of 365 24 3600 seconds 1 year and waits for other timeouts to occur, such as tcpip timeouts.

779 1074 1212 1490 1406 527 1145 495 1259 864 353 1627 1522 902 1647 1283 874 1583 482 4 1560 1590 1660 646 991 326 9 1415 743 199 566 632